Belarusian First League Champions

Derived from previous season tables
Season Champion P W D L GD Pts Runner-up
2025 FC Baranovichi logo FC Baranovichi 34 23 5 6 +46 74 Dnepr Mogilev
2024 FC Molodechno logo FC Molodechno 34 23 7 4 +36 76 FC Belshina Babruisk
2023 Arsenal Dzerzhinsk logo Arsenal Dzerzhinsk 32 26 3 3 +56 81 Dnepr Mogilev
2022 Naftan Novopolotsk logo Naftan Novopolotsk 24 16 5 3 +36 53 Smorgon FC
2021 Arsenal Dzerzhinsk logo Arsenal Dzerzhinsk 32 19 8 5 +34 65 FC Belshina Babruisk
2020 Sputnik Rechitsa logo Sputnik Rechitsa 26 19 4 3 +32 61 FC Gomel
2019 FC Belshina Babruisk logo FC Belshina Babruisk 28 21 5 2 +52 68 Smolevichy-STI
2018 Slavia Mozyr logo Slavia Mozyr 28 20 8 0 +52 68 Energetik-BGU Minsk
2017 Luch Minsk logo Luch Minsk 30 19 10 1 +42 67 Smolevichy-STI
2016 Dnepr Mogilev logo Dnepr Mogilev 26 20 4 2 +42 64 FC Gomel
2015 FK Isloch Minsk logo FK Isloch Minsk 30 20 9 1 +52 69 FK Gorodeya
2014 Granit Mikashevichi logo Granit Mikashevichi 30 19 7 4 +30 64 Slavia Mozyr
